If you live in Manhattan and want to learn Spanish, Swahili or even Swedish then youre reading the right article. Langua World has been helping NYCs residents talk to the world since 1994.

In fact, they were voted Best of New York 2008 by the U.S. Local Business Association for Language Schools because of their commitment to student comprehension.

They achieved this distinction by limiting class size, by providing a huge language selection to choose from , by delivering a personal approach to each student, and by staffing the classes with highly skilled instructors.

Their staff is comprised only of native speakers who are certified to teach their given language.

Plus, they dont lecture! Fun and interactive games encourage tremendously fast learning for real world application.

Another way they get such fast results is by limiting the size of their classes to 7 students or less.

This intimate approach is additionally galvanized by monthly gatherings of students of all levels. Again, the emphasis is on application through interaction. This is a working process more than an academic one.

Students choose from 48 languages, enjoy a hands-on approach designed for immediate results, and become part of the schools multicultural community. If you want to live and think in a new language, New Yorks best is waiting for you!
